I have made hats for years and years using an old Soviet/Russian mathematical method (I have no idea what it is called), essentially by drawing side, front and top views of the hat in scale and then cutting them into little squares on a grid and flattening them, much like you do in sheetmetal drafting.
Now that I’ve got a little downtime, I’ve been thinking of transferring few of the basic shapes into a parametric form for Seamly 2D, but I am not sure what’s the best aproach to try and do this.
I’ve essentially got two hat shapes that I need to make parametric.
First one is a typical “military” hat kind of a hat, where you’ve got a roughly oval cylinder (of unequal height back and front) with a bill. The other one is a sort of a Pilotka (Russian side cap) looking fellow.
There are a ton of historical uniforms (military, post office, customs etc.) that use these two basic shapes here with some differences in their shapes.
So I am looking to having a parametric settings for the “military hat”:
- Head oval length & width
- Head oval “cubeness”
- Back & front height
- Bill width and length
For the sidecap:
- Head oval length & width
- Head oval “cubeness”
- Back & front height
All the other measurements would essentially follow from these.
Here’s a few screenshots I took out of Blender of the hats that I roughly modeled just for illustration purposes.
Since the head oval isn’t a perfect oval and the cylinder itself in the military hat is “leaning forward”, you can’t just make the side panels just with two curves, the radius is slightly smaller in the “corners” of the ovals.
